Here are 3 asian inspired dessert spots in nyc you would not want to miss:
The Original Chinatown Ice Cream Factory
Location: Chinatown
Price: $5 / scoop
Review: This is the perfect spot to grab dessert if you’re craving Asian flavors. My personal favs are black sesame and lychee rose. But they have all types of different Asian flavors, and I really like them bc they’re not super sweet.

Location: Chinatown
Price: $12 for maiko special, $13 for shogun special (swirl on cone with golden leaf)
Review: Matcha Maiko is a dessert café serving everything matcha. They have the best matcha soft serve I’ve ever had. You can just taste the quality of the matcha. They also have seasonal special flavors, some that I’ve seen include calpico, peach oolong and ube! The only drawback here is that it is quite expensive at $12 for the maiko special.
